IN ZONE N GENERAL NOTES: 1-The contractor shall provide all labor ,materials, connectors , supplies and shall perform all operation for the complete and total installation of all construction work shown and or implied on the drawings , including but not limited to the following any appliance and/or if called for in detail , without additional cost to the owner. 2-The contractor shall verify dimensions and job conditions prior to submitting bids and report to the engineer any discrepancies and/or omissions which would interfere with the satisfactory completion of the work , as detailed on the drawings and or specified herein. 3-Drawings are not to be scaled for accuracy of placement or location due the nature of reproduction process. Improper placement shall be the responsibility of the contractor to repair, 4-All work shall be of sound construction, consistent with the best building practices of the individual trade. 5-All materials shall be new and unused (unless otherwise noted for relocation or installation) All defective materials furnished and/or installed by the contractor shall be removed and replaced at the contractor's expense without delay of work. 6-All materials or equipment utilized on the job shall comply with the requirement of the latest edition of the APPROVED Local Building Code , The National Electrical and Plumbing Codes , Disability Act , Florida Access Code and all Local Codes and Ordinances as may apply to any portion of the work . 7-The contractor shall remove any debris as it accumulates and shall not allow discarded materials to accumulate. Each Sub -contractor shall be responsible to police their area of work and pick up their discarded materials and waste . 8-All necessary inspection certificates , permits and licenses as may be required are to be obtained at the contractor's expense . PLUMBING NOTES -The work shall comply with all Federal, State, County and Local Law Regulations and Ordinances affecting the work , to include "The Standard Building Code" ,The Standard Plumbing Code", "The Standard Mechanical Code" and all Local & State Codes in force at the time of construction. -Make all connections to existing water and sewer utilities as may be required, modify the existing utilities as may be required to make the necessary connection. -Provide all excavation and backfilling as required . Lay underground piping only on tampered well connected soil -fill to meet required compaction. -Water piping, fittings and connection shall be type "K" copper tubing below grade and type "L" above grade . -Insulate all hot water piping with ARMAFLEX H , 1 inch minimum thickness. -Potable water system shall be soldered with "NO LEAD" solder. -Clean and flush all piping and fixtures . -Sterilize all potable water piping systems to meet AWWA C160-54 and flush test all systems . -Test all systems , test water piping to 150 PSI with valves full open. -Test DWV piping to 10 feet water head CERTIFICATION SIGNING & SEALING OF PLAN BY ENGINEER IS FOR REVIEW OF COMPLIANCE WITH 2O17 (FBC) FLORIDA BUILDING CODE AS APPLICABLE FOR THE SPECIFIC RESIDENCE AND ONLY VALID IF IT BEARS THE SIGNATURE DATE & RAISED EMBOSSED SEAL OF THE DESIGN ENGINEER.
